Sabotage on the ISS?

Somebody call Inspector Clouseau and get him fitted up for a spacesuit. The recent puncture of the Soyuz space capsule docked at the International Space Station (ISS) in August has turned into a mystery which may wind up being a movie script. It was initially assumed that the tiny, two-millimeter hole which perforated the capsule […]

